 Structure of an anti-shock device

An improvement in the structure of an anti-shock device utilized for buildings, important structures and bridge structures that includes a base, a carrier, a slide block, and a plurality of springs. A slip concavity of a sunken round curved recess is respectively formed in the base top surface and in the carrier bottom surface, and an upper slide block member and a lower slide block member are situated between the two slip concavities. One contact surface between the two slide block members and slip concavities is of a curved contour and the other surfaces are indented seating recesses. A spheroid coupling bearing is nested between the two seating recesses and the upper and lower slide block members are held together by the springs. As so assembled, the anti-shock device base is fastened under the columns of a building structure such that the building achieves the objectives of exceptional shock eliminating capability and greater building structure safety.

DETAILED DESCRIPTION This invention is related to shock eliminators, and in particular to an improved structure of an anti-shock device utilized in buildings, residences, important structures and bridges.
It is the primary object of the present invention to provide an improvement in the structure of an anti-shock device utilized in buildings, residences, important structures and bridges which have a double action sliding and swiveling mechanism that increases shock elimination capacity to effectively and economically ensure building structure safety.
